Note:
Vessel Operating Common Carriers (VOCCs) own their vessels.
Non Vessel Operating Common Carriers (NVOCCs) lease space on vessels owned by VOCCs. NVOCCs can consolidate freight from various shippers and their rates are generally competitive with VOCCs.
Freight Forwarders are similar to NVOCCs and also lease space on VOCCs. They will handle paperwork, find best rate on VOCCs, and consolidate cargo from various shippers. Like NVOCCs, they have more bargaining power with VOCCs than a single shipper of small freight would have; their rates are generally higher than VOCCs and NVOCCs because they offer more services to the shipper.

Sea-Land: Sea-Land provides regular service from the Atlantic, Gulf and Pacific Coasts of the United States to all areas of the region. Sea-Land calls the ports of Vostochny in the Russian Far East, the Ukrainian port of Mariupol, and the Baltic ports of Riga, Latvia, and St. Petersburg, Russia. The St. Petersburg facility includes their own secure off dock container yard. They are equipped to ship 20 and 40 foot containers, 40 foot high-cubes and can ship 40 foot refrigerated containers into Russia via Helsinki. Sea Land has signed an exclusive agreement with Sovmortrans to act as their local agent in Moscow and St. Petersburg. Together, they have established a joint venture trucking company that transports containers from St. Petersburg to inland points up to 2,000 kilometers away.

Sea-Land has also established the Trans-Siberian Express Service (TSES). This joint venture with the Russian Ministry of Railways, offers express rail containers service for both import and transit cargoes. The TSES border to border rail transit time is 13 days, approximately haves the distance of an all water service. Sea-Land will use its established transportation hubs throughout the region to forward 20 foot container shipments to Tashkent, Uzbekistan. From Tashkent, containers will be forwarded to final destinations throughout Central Asia. Currently, the existing transport facilities are being modernized to support the use of 40 foot containers.
